What is Lingt?
Lingt is a site that allows your instructor to create assignments that require you to type or speak your responses. We hope that, by supplementing the usual reading and writing assignments with Lingt's media-rich spoken assignments, you'll come away from class with a much better grasp of the material.Accessing your teacher's assignments.
Accessing your teacher's classes and assignments is as easy as going to lingtlanguage.com/your-teacher's-username. Your teacher should have given you his or her username when assigning a Lingt assignment.Completing an assignment.
The first thing you should do when accessing an assignment is give Lingt permission to access your computer's microphone. You will be prompted to do this the first time you take a Lingt assignment and never again after that. Just be sure to check 'remember' or things won't work correctly.To complete an assignment, simply provide responses to the empty talk bubbles (see next question) and fill in text-boxes with text. When done, press the "submit" button at below the assignment. Just give the digital equivalent of a signature, hit "submit," and you're done. By the way, we only ask for your email so we can streamline teacher feedback to your submission. We promise not to give it away or spam you.
Using the record bubble.
The record bubble is Lingt's widget-of-choice for recording your voice. Once you've tried it a couple of times, it will be perfectly natural. Click the bubble once to start recording - make sure you don't start talking until the loading animation disappears. Click the bubble again to listen to the sample you just recorded. If you want, you can redo a submission by clicking the little "x" in the upper right corner of the bubble when you hover over it. Easy.Configuring your microphone.
Most of the time, Flash will automatically detect the correct microphone and you can begin recording without a problem. However, sometimes you will need to manually tell Flash to use a microphone other than the default. To do this, click "Choose Mic" in the upper right corner of the screen when you are taking an assignment. You can choose a new microphone from the drop-down menu and check the audio bar on the left of the Flash box to see if your voice is being detected. Unfortunately, all the record bubbles must be reloaded when you change mics, so the page will refresh when you do so. Since Lingt is an entirely online service, our technical requirements are very easy to meet. In fact, you probably already meet them:- Flash 9 or above.
- Lingt works best in Internet Explorer 7+, Firefox 2+, and Safari, but other browsers may work as well. Lingt also works in Internet Explorer 6 - just barely.
- A microphone. This can be external or built-in to your computer.
